The video game industry landscape has undergone a seismic shift with the announcement that Electronic Arts has been acquired in a $55 billion private transaction by a group of investors including Saudi Arabia’s Public Investment Fund. This massive deal has created an unexpected new milestone for one of gaming’s most anticipated titles: Grand Theft Auto VI.

With EA now under new ownership, Take-Two Interactive—parent company of Rockstar Games—has become the largest independent publisher in the gaming industry. This positions GTA 6, scheduled for release on May 26, 2026, as the flagship title from what is now the biggest standalone game publisher not part of a larger corporate conglomerate.
The acquisition has sparked mixed reactions across the industry. While EA CEO Andrew Wilson expressed enthusiasm about “unlocking new opportunities” under the new ownership, concerns have emerged about how the acquisition might affect EA’s franchises known for inclusive storytelling, particularly given Saudi Arabia’s laws regarding LGBTQIA+ relationships.
For Take-Two and Rockstar Games, however, this development reinforces their independent status. The company had previously demonstrated its commitment to independence in 2008 when it rejected an acquisition offer from EA, believing in its higher long-term value. That decision now appears prescient as Take-Two stands alone as the industry’s largest independent publisher just as it prepares to launch what may be the biggest game in history.
This independent status provides reassurance to GTA 6 fans that the creative vision for the Vice City adventure will remain uncompromised by external corporate influences. The game, already breaking records for anticipation levels, now carries the additional distinction of being the flagship release from gaming’s newest major independent publisher.
